Council Member Pennino requested follow-up information on his proposal for procedure
revision with regard to the consent calendar. (City Attorney McNatt advised that no other
Council Members, having received the information on possible revisions to the agenda
format, indicated interest in pursuing the matter.) Further, Mr. Pennino remarked an the
following: 1) he had a recent conversation with investors regarding Hotel Lodi and their
concerns over parking availability; 2) inquired as to the health of Building Maintenance
Superintendent Dennis Callahan (Public Works Director Ronsko assured Mr. Pennino that
Mr. Callahan was fine and had returned to work on a modified full-time schedule); and 3)
asked that staff check on status of a light signal at the intersection of Vine Street and
Lower Sacramento Road.

Subject: Traffic Signal Priority List and Lower Sacramento Road at Vine Street
At the last City Council meeting, during the comments by the Council, a question was asked
about the status of the traffic signal priority list and the intersection of Lower Sacramento Road
at Vine Street. The list, as it was last updated in 1991, and the current status of each location is:

Preliminary engineering on the Lower Sacramento Road widening project will start in 1995. Staff
has assumed that the Vine Street signal would be included in this project. One problem will be
that right-of-way will be needed on the southwest corner unless we plan to install temporary
facilities that would need to be relocated later.
The entire priority list is due to be updated. Included in Engineering's 1995/96 operating budget
request is the resttion of pajt-time help to obtain traffic counts for this labor-intensive task.
